Output 658954d9a30e6702f78d4a17ac9c79a5febe204ef8e10496d1a8c9ffb6c01367:3

value
344586
script pubkey
OP_0 OP_PUSHBYTES_20 a9520958e977fbe22345f85131ad4c644348a49d
address
bc1q49fqjk8fwla7yg69lpgnrt2vv3p53fyaxlut8x
transaction
658954d9a30e6702f78d4a17ac9c79a5febe204ef8e10496d1a8c9ffb6c01367
spent
true